2020 Chicago Bears control destiny after 41-17 win at Jacksonville
The way the team puts it, they have been in the a continuous series of one game playoffs for the past three weeks. Their win against the Jaguars, coupled with Arizona's loss to San Francisco leaves the Chicago Bears in control of their own destiny. That's no easy feat with the final game of the 2020 regular season at hand. 2020 Chicago Bears Stop Skid with 36-7 Win Over Texans
The 2020 Chicago Bears finally won a game. The Bears defense ended their fall/winter hibernation and showed up. Khalil Mack had a sack, a QB hit, a safety, and a fumble recovery. The Bears had a game with no turnovers. Weeks ago, Matt Nagy proclaimed that this team had not showed its true potential, when all three phases would be in sync. 2020 Chicago Bears Staggering from Sixth Straight Loss
The Detroit Lions should have been the panacea to cure the 2020 Chicago Bears five game skid. Instead, the Lions scored twice in the last two minutes of the game to upend their NFC North rivals. The final score was aided by a strip sack on 3rd and 4 inside their own 20 yard line. Detroit scored two plays later.
